How to Convert Muon Mass to Atomic Mass Unit
1 m_mu = 0.11342892388895 u
Example: convert 15 m_mu to u:
15 m_mu = 15 × 0.11342892388895 u = 1.70143385833425 u

Muon Mass
The muon mass (m_mu) is the rest mass of the muon particle, approximately 105.66 MeV/c² or 1.8835 × 10⁻28 kilograms.
History/Origin
The muon was discovered in 1936 by Carl Anderson and Seth Neddermeyer during cosmic ray experiments. Its mass was later measured and confirmed through particle physics experiments, establishing it as a fundamental lepton similar to the electron but significantly more massive.
Current Use
The muon mass is used in particle physics calculations, experimental physics, and in the calibration of detectors involving muons. It also aids in understanding fundamental particle properties and interactions within the Standard Model.
Atomic Mass Unit
The atomic mass unit (u) is a standard unit of mass used to express atomic and molecular weights, defined as one twelfth of the mass of a carbon-12 atom.
History/Origin
The atomic mass unit was introduced in the early 20th century to provide a convenient scale for atomic weights. It was originally based on the mass of hydrogen but was later standardized to be one twelfth of the mass of a carbon-12 atom, which was adopted as a reference in 1961 by the IUPAC.
Current Use
The atomic mass unit is widely used in chemistry and physics to express atomic and molecular masses, facilitating calculations in molecular chemistry, nuclear physics, and related fields.
